簡體   English   中英

未知的編譯器選項“noImplicitOverride”

[英]Unknown compiler option 'noImplicitOverride'

在帶有 Typescript 4.5.2 的 angular 13 應用程序中,我在 tsconfig.json 文件中遇到錯誤。 “noImplicitOverride”設置為 true 並給出“未知編譯器選項 'noImplicitOverride'.ts”。 我已將其設置為 false,但仍然出現錯誤。

{
"baseUrl": "./",
"outDir": "./dist/out-tsc",
"forceConsistentCasingInFileNames": true,
"strict": true,
"noImplicitOverride": true ,
"noPropertyAccessFromIndexSignature": true,
"noImplicitReturns": true,
"noFallthroughCasesInSwitch": true,
"sourceMap": true,
"declaration": false,
"downlevelIteration": true,
"experimentalDecorators": true,
"moduleResolution": "node",
"importHelpers": true,
"target": "es2017",
"module": "es2020",
"lib": [
  "es2020",
  "dom"
]

我遇到了同樣的問題。 我回滾到 Typescript 4.4.2 並且錯誤消失了。

要解決此問題,我必須在 Visual Studio 解決方案中安裝 NuGet package Microsoft.TypeScript.Z8849EA3BFBB651F3AA04CD60。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M